Python是一種流行的編程語言,被廣泛應(yīng)用于各種領(lǐng)域。其中,使用Python來購買京東商品也是一個(gè)不錯(cuò)的選擇。
import requests
# 設(shè)置請求頭部信息
headers = {
'Referer': 'https://www.jd.com/',
'User-Agent': 'Mozilla/5.0 (Macintosh; Intel Mac OS X 10_13_6)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/72.0.3626.109 Safari/537.36'
}
# 構(gòu)造請求參數(shù)
params = {
'keyword': '手機(jī)',
'enc': 'utf-8'
}
# 發(fā)送請求
response = requests.get('https://search.jd.com/Search', headers=headers, params=params)
# 解析響應(yīng)數(shù)據(jù)
result = response.text
print(result)
以上代碼實(shí)現(xiàn)了發(fā)送請求并得到京東搜索結(jié)果的功能。可以根據(jù)自己的需求進(jìn)行修改,比如修改搜索的關(guān)鍵詞、加入登錄等功能。
在得到搜索結(jié)果后,我們還可以使用Python進(jìn)行下單和支付。截至目前,京東并沒有正式開放API接口供開發(fā)者使用,所以這部分需要自己研究和開發(fā)。
總之,Python和京東購買的結(jié)合,為我們提供了更加便捷的購物體驗(yàn),也為我們的編程技能提供了更加豐富的應(yīng)用場景。